Acclaimed composer/writer/performer David Yazbek will return to the stage at Joe's Pub with his remarkable band for the first time in four years. The concert will take place Wednesday, May 30, 2012 at 7:30pm and will feature songs from Yazbek's album "Evil Monkey Man" on Ghostlight Records, plus new works and songs from his other albums and his recent Broadway show Women on the Verge of a Nervous Breakdown.  

Three-time Tony nominee, Grammy nominee, Emmy and Drama Desk winner, winner of the N.A.I.R.D. award for Best Album and writer of the unrelenting "Where In The World Is Carmen Sandiego" theme song, Yazbek will take to the stage at Joe's Pub to do what he does best: sing his own songs and punish the grand piano while stamping his right foot with great vigor. David Yazbek is a long-time cult favorite-a recording artist, vocalist and pianist known for his thrilling live performances and irreverent style. His Broadway shows The Full MontyDirty Rotten Scoundrels and Women on the Verge…  have played in over 20 countries. His first album, The Laughing Man, won the N.A.I.R.D. Award for Best Pop Album of the Year. He is also a Grammy-nominated record producer and an Emmy-Award winning TV writer (for Late Night with David Letterman).
